Subject: Data-centre cage visit — Thursday morning

Hi Facilities team,

A technician from Bryllan Networks is scheduled to access the Cage 7 racks in the Oakhurst data hall on Thursday between 09:00 and 11:00. Please ensure the anteroom is unlocked and the visit is logged in the access register. The technician must be escorted at all times inside the hall. For the cage door, use the code below.

badge for fafop-fajof: bdg-Z-47

## Search relevance tuning notes

If your plugin contributes documents to the Quarrel search index, be aware that ranking weights are tuned centrally — plugins should not attempt client-side score boosting. Field-level boosts, synonym sets, and freshness decay are reviewed quarterly by the relevance group, and plugin-supplied metadata feeds into those signals. Current weight tables, tuning history, and the change-request process are published on the internal page here.

runbook for badug-kadup: https://confluence.zemvarlabs.internal/projects/browse/display/projects/bd1b

- [ ] Circuit breaker on the Quillfeather upstream API: double-check the trip threshold (5 failures / 30s) and make sure fallback responses don't leak internal error detail. Security folks, please eyeball the half-open retry path too — we had a sketchy timeout there last cycle. Once you've signed off, note the build you tested against right below this line.

build token for kajeg-bageg: htk6_abeb3e